Output 2f59bf33dbe69b987d4f7d32266d251b9ec9d053e3d3b10c8ea18ee133674f73:0

value
72769063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28f1af698ed10a29a00019e924fdc3e3ccb9f08d OP_EQUALVERIFY OP_CHECKSIG
address
14jVZFptVjr659EXgtPCQZZUm4eJincD8B
transaction
2f59bf33dbe69b987d4f7d32266d251b9ec9d053e3d3b10c8ea18ee133674f73
confirmations
553903
spent
true